The role ofInnovation Manageris to support complex change by bringing energy, expertise, and empathy to bear in the development, execution, and management of innovation projects in the health & social care sector in NW London.
The roleenables and supports project delivery and programme delivery, drawing on skills and practices relating to problem definition, scoping and planning, research and analysis, project management, and reflecting and learning.
The role also includes active participation in thedevelopment and culture of ICHPas an organisation, sharing responsibility for making ICHP a great place to work, and taking a specificmanagerial responsibility for the development of colleagues
The post-holder willlead on several (e.g. two-to-three) external projectsat one time, and potentially provide input / advice to several others. This will include a mixture of shorter-term projects (of circa six to twelve weeks), and projects within longer term programmes of activity (circa twelve months).
The post-holder is responsible forshaping and overseeing the delivery of projects(including coordinating research, analysis, and materials production), working withsignificant self-directionand directing others; and for managing various inputs to ensure the completion of projects to time and within the allocated resources.
Imperial College Health Partners (ICHP):
Imperial College Health Partners (hosted by Chelsea and Westminster NHS Foundation Trust) is a partnership organisation bringing together NHS providers of healthcare services, clinical commissioning groups and leading universities across North-West London. We have been designated by NHS England as the Health Innovation (HIN) for North-West London, and we are one of 15 HINs across England which make upThe Health Innovation Network.
We were created by the NHS to support complex change across the health and care sector – innovating and collaborating for a healthier population. We work collaboratively on a portfolio of innovation projects known as the NWL Missions. These have been identified as:
1. Optimising care of long-term conditions (starting with CVD)
2. Enabling more days at home
3. Supporting children and young people’s mental health.
We also deliver National commissions such as the Patient Safety Collaborative, and theInnovation Exchangewhich focuses on supporting innovators and industry partners.
